Another thing you might try, if you really think that your problem is related to the Windows Update, then open device manager, expand network connection, right click the problem adapter(s), choose properties, select the driver tab at the top of the properties dialog box, and choose "Roll Back Driver" see if that helps.
In order to prevent Windows update from updating drivers in the future;
right click on "Computer" choose properties
in the left column choose "Advanced system settings"
in the system properties dialog box choose the hardware tab then
click the button that says "Device Installation Settings"
Then choose "No, let me choose what to do:
and then Never install driver software from Windows Update.
I have found that in most instances, if not all, device drivers are best obtained from either the computer manufacturer's website, or the actual device manufacturer's website and would only use Windows Updates for driver files if both the previous options failed.
